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/infra/gmfdiag/org.eclipse.papyrus.extensionpoints.editors/schema/DirectEditor.exsd')
-rw-r--r--plugins/infra/gmfdiag/org.eclipse.papyrus.extensionpoints.editors/schema/DirectEditor.exsd27
1 files changed, 20 insertions, 7 deletions
diff --git a/plugins/infra/gmfdiag/org.eclipse.papyrus.extensionpoints.editors/schema/DirectEditor.exsd b/plugins/infra/gmfdiag/org.eclipse.papyrus.extensionpoints.editors/schema/DirectEditor.exsd
index 12fa2214dce..d8dc6a7a3e8 100644
--- a/plugins/infra/gmfdiag/org.eclipse.papyrus.extensionpoints.editors/schema/DirectEditor.exsd
+++ b/plugins/infra/gmfdiag/org.eclipse.papyrus.extensionpoints.editors/schema/DirectEditor.exsd
@@ -75,8 +75,11 @@
<attribute name="objectToEdit" type="string" use="required">
<annotation>
<documentation>
- the qualified type of object to edit (for example, &quot;java.lang.Object&quot;)
+ The type of object to edit (for example, &quot;org.eclipse.emf.ecore.EObject&quot;)
</documentation>
+ <appInfo>
+ <meta.attribute kind="java" basedOn=":org.eclipse.emf.ecore.EObject"/>
+ </appInfo>
</annotation>
</attribute>
<attribute name="icon" type="string">
@@ -96,6 +99,16 @@
</documentation>
</annotation>
</attribute>
+ <attribute name="additionalConstraint" type="string">
+ <annotation>
+ <documentation>
+
+ </documentation>
+ <appInfo>
+ <meta.attribute kind="java" basedOn=":org.eclipse.papyrus.extensionpoints.editors.configuration.IDirectEditorConstraint"/>
+ </appInfo>
+ </annotation>
+ </attribute>
</complexType>
</element>
@@ -183,28 +196,28 @@
<annotation>
<appInfo>
- <meta.section type="apiInfo"/>
+ <meta.section type="since"/>
</appInfo>
<documentation>
- [Enter API information here.]
+ Since 1.9.0
</documentation>
</annotation>
<annotation>
<appInfo>
- <meta.section type="since"/>
+ <meta.section type="examples"/>
</appInfo>
<documentation>
- Since 1.9.0
+ [Enter extension point usage example here.]
</documentation>
</annotation>
<annotation>
<appInfo>
- <meta.section type="examples"/>
+ <meta.section type="apiInfo"/>
</appInfo>
<documentation>
- [Enter extension point usage example here.]
+ [Enter API information here.]
</documentation>
</annotation>

Back to the top